Donald Sanford Sucher



Donald Sanford Sucher, 89, of Georgetown, KY, formerly of Detroit, died on 15 February 2015.

The Funeral was out of state on Sunday, 22 February 2015.

Family members include:
He leaves behind his wife of 53 years, Shirley, three sons, Bruce (Kelly), Jeffrey (Karen) and Steve as well as one daughter, Carmie. He also leaves 6 grandchildren. Brother of the late Gerald (the late Jean) Sucher, the late Irene Sucher Bader, the late Shirley Sucher Cohen (the late Bernard M Cohen). Brother in law of Martin Bader. Also survived by his loving caregiver Mary Green.

Donald served in WWII in the navy, he was a Member of the Kentucky Colonels. He raced sailboats and was commodore of the Great Lakes Yacht Club. Donald and Shirley owned Echo Valley Horse Farm and bred Kentucky Derby winner Winning Colors in 1988 and also Chris Evert, winner of the filly triple crown. He loved golf and going to horse shows with his daughter. He was a member of the Keeneland Club, the Thoroughbred Club, and Greenbrier Golf and CC. Donald never met a stranger and was kind to everyone.
